Historically, it was a medical professional's instruction to an apothecary listing the resources to generally be compounded right into a treatment method—the image ℞ (a capital letter R, crossed to indicate abbreviation) originates from the first term of the medieval prescription, Latin recipe (lit. 'choose thou'), that gave the list of the components being compounded.

The Joint Commission notes an exception for the Trailing Zero warning. They point out that a “trailing zero may be used only when necessary to exhibit the extent of precision of the value getting described, like for laboratory results, imaging scientific studies that report the dimensions of lesions, or catheter/tube dimensions. It is probably not Utilized in medication orders or other medication-similar documentation."
Around-the-counter medications and non-managed clinical provides like dressings, here which do not need a prescription, may additionally be prescribed. Depending on a jurisdiction's health care method, non-prescription drugs may be prescribed simply because drug profit options could reimburse the patient provided that the more than-the-counter medication is taken within the route of a qualified healthcare practitioner.
